Your team

Pictet Asset Management’s ESG team leads and co-ordinates the implementation of responsible investment principles throughout the firm. We are looking for a corporate engagement specialist to engage with companies on social and environmental matters, to be based in Geneva or London.

Your role

  • Defining, together with the investment teams, a target list of companies and themes for engagement on ESG-related matters.

  • Identifying the most relevant channels for conducting corporate engagements (e.g. bilateral, collaborative and third-party provider).

  • Coordinating and taking part in bilateral and/or collaborative engagements with companies on specific environmental and social issues, and steering related discussions with investment teams.

  • Helping investment teams to take part in engagements led by our third-party provider, and providing ongoing monitoring of this service.

  • Depending on engagement outcomes, preparing and presenting voting recommendations on specific resolutions.

  • Helping to enhance our firm-wide approach to active ownership, including by issuing policies, procedures and guidelines on corporate engagement.

  • Contributing to internal and external reporting on active ownership activities.

  • Attending relevant conferences, and joining industry associations and working groups.
